Subject: Cut-over done — health checks behind the LB

Hey Priya,

Quick recap before you review: we flipped traffic on Lanternfish to the new pool last night. The balancer now hits /healthz every 10s with a 3-strike eviction, and we dropped the old TCP-only probe that kept masking bad deploys. Drain time is 30s, which matched what we saw in staging at the Bremholt site. No 5xx spikes since cut-over. The exact settings the pool is running with are below.

settings of fafog-haduf:
ZORIX_PIN=4648
ZORIX_METRICS_HOST=metrics.zorix.paliqsys.corp
ZORIX_LOG_LEVEL=info
ZORIX_TENANT=druix

Ticket: Staging env misconfigured for Siftgate bloom filter

The bloom layer in front of the Pellet KV store is rejecting all lookups in staging because the env file was copied from the dev template without credentials. False-positive tuning values are fine; only the auth line is missing. To unblock the weekly demo, the Pellet admission secret must be set on the following line.

env line for yaguf-fajop: LEDGER_TOKEN13=fb08984397349

Handover for the weekly eng sync: I'm transferring ownership of Duskrunner, our nightly backfill scheduler, to Priya. Current state: all jobs healthy except the ledger-reconciliation backfill, which retries once nightly due to a slow upstream from the Kestwick warehouse. Retry logic, window sizing, and concurrency caps were all tuned carefully last quarter — please don't change them without a load test. For full transparency at the sync, the production instance runs with these configuration values.

settings of hawep-kadug:
RALAEL_HOST=ralael.tolvaqlabs.internal
RALAEL_PORT=9000

## Deploying the Gatewick Proctor Queue

Deploys are pretty painless: push to main, wait for the pipeline, then watch the queue drain dashboard for five minutes. If candidates pile up mid-exam, roll back first and ask questions later — the queue replays safely. Everything the workers care about lives in one config block, shown here for reference.

settings of bafof-yagef:
JOROX_PIN=8740
JOROX_TENANT=pelox
JOROX_METRICS_HOST=metrics.jorox.qorvelworks.internal
JOROX_SEAL=seal_c78f63c1
JOROX_STANDBY_TEAM=norax